Responsibilities
- Technical leader responsible for managing day-to-day engineering details associated with a new program launch
- Ensure that engineering deliverables are successfully achieved on time and within budget
- Create, optimize, and influence product designs utilizing prototype and pre-production builds, mock-up trials, internal and external customer collaboration
- Develop best part design for tooling and process for production plant manufacturing teams
- Apply existing knowledge, risk assessment, and best practices throughout the product development cycle
- Apply and comply with GD&T to meet customer, assembly, and manufacturing requirements
- Manage part design initial release & engineering changes while adhering to drawing & data management processes and procedures
- Develop initial part DFMEA and DFM
- Create and release product bill of materials
- Lead root cause analysis activities for problem solving
- Develop and execute DV and PV testing plans
- Lead material cost reduction and optimization projects
- Apply comprehensive knowledge of customer, regulatory, and internal manufacturing requirements
- Support all above activities for ongoing engineering change management as needed

About Us
Motus Integrated Technologies is a dynamic, half-billion-dollar global leader in manufacturing high-quality headliners and interior trim products for the automotive industry. Headquartered in Holland, Michigan, Motus operates advanced manufacturing facilities across North America (U.S. and Mexico) and maintains a global presence with 5 locations. Motus is part of the Atlas Holdings portfolio, an industrial holding company based in Greenwich, Connecticut.
